Honour for Huawei

(From left) Rammohan, D’Souza, Zhang and Chebli

HUAWEI has been adjudged the Middle East’s Wireless Vendor of the Year.

The company received its prize at the sixth Network World ME Awards 2015, which took place at the Jumeirah Beach Hotel in Dubai.

Huawei received the accolade as a result of its work delivering next-generation wireless broadband deployments for enterprises in the UAE such as the Jannah Hotel Group, Emirates Golf Club and Al Noor Training Centre for Children with Special Needs.

The judging panel comprised leading industry experts including Arun Tewary, chief information officer, vice president for IT and Emirates flight catering; Esam Hadi, Aluminium Bahrain’s senior IT manager; Madhav Rao, Emke Group’s CIO, and Paul Black, IDC’s director of telecoms and media for the Middle East, Africa and Turkey.

Jeevan Thankappan, group editor of the technology division at CPI Media Group, said: “Huawei was chosen as the wireless vendor of the year by the Network World ME Awards judging panel for its focus on customers, breadth of products, solutions and major customer acquisitions in the region.”

With a strong heritage of building and deploying wireless broadband networks in the region, Huawei showcased its latest WiFi networking projects that it deployed for enterprises in the UAE.

Huawei’s fastest WiFi deployments include its recent partnership with ‘golf in DUBAi’, which brought seamless WiFi connectivity to the 2014 Omega Dubai Desert Classic Golf Tournament connecting up to 2,000 guests at the same time. The company also rolled out the UAE’s fastest hotel WiFi for Jannah Hotels & Resorts.

In addition, Huawei deployed a new campus-wide WiFi network for Al Noor Training Centre for Children with Special Needs, which seamlessly connects teachers and students with the center’s digital learning platforms. Other work included deploying a transmission network on the Dubai Metro through du that is now providing access to mobile services in 18 metro stops.

Founded in 1987, Huawei’s ICT solutions, products and services are used in more than 170 countries and regions, serving over one-third of the world’s population.
